Web8 Aug 2024 · The high-end steaks we're talking about are the ribeye, strip loin, tenderloin, T-bone and Porterhouse steaks. These cuts come from high up on the animal, from muscles that don't get much exercise, which is why they're so tender. But those cuts make up just 8% of the beef carcass. Web6 Jul 2024 · Cooking the hanger steak. Grease the grid with some oil. Sprinkle the hanger steak with some salt and place it on the barbecue. Grill both sides for 2 minutes for a red result and 3 minutes for a slightly more rosé color. Remove the meat from the barbecue and cut it diagonally against the wire into thin strips. Cut the Ribeye into … pottermore hogwarts houseWeb22 Mar 2024 · More specifically, the rib primal is separated from the chuck primal at the 5th/6th rib. The rib primal is also separated from the loin primal at the 12th/13th rib. Meaning, ribeye steaks are essentially the meat from ribs 6 - 12.
